Type Analysis
Direct TPMS Application: This segment demonstrates projected growth of 10%-12%, driven by superior accuracy, comprehensive monitoring capabilities, and premium vehicle market expansion. Direct TPMS systems provide precise pressure readings, temperature monitoring, and individual tire identification, commanding premium pricing for advanced functionality.Indirect TPMS Application: Expected to grow at 7%-9%, serving cost-sensitive market segments and vehicles equipped with existing wheel speed sensor infrastructure. This segment benefits from lower system costs, simplified installation requirements, and integration with anti-lock braking system components.

Challenges
- Regulatory Harmonization: Varying TPMS regulations across global markets create compliance complexity for system manufacturers requiring different technical specifications, testing procedures, and certification requirements. Achieving regulatory harmonization remains an ongoing industry challenge.
- Cost Competition Pressure: Intense price competition in automotive component markets creates pressure for cost reduction while maintaining system performance, reliability, and automotive quality standards. Balancing cost competitiveness with advanced functionality remains challenging.
- Technical Integration Complexity: Increasing vehicle electronic system complexity requires sophisticated TPMS integration with multiple vehicle networks, diagnostic systems, and advanced driver assistance technologies, creating technical challenges for seamless system operation across diverse vehicle platforms.
- Battery Management Requirements: Direct TPMS sensors must operate throughout vehicle service life using internal batteries, creating ongoing challenges for power optimization, temperature compensation, and reliable wireless communication under demanding automotive operating conditions.
